Can humans drink heavy water?

You can drink a glass of heavy water and won’t suffer any ill effects. If you drink a few glasses, you might feel dizzy because some of the heavy water would change the density of fluid in your inner ear. If you only drink heavy water, eventually D2O molecules replaces enough H2O to cause problems.

What is the purpose of heavy water in nuclear reactor?

Heavy water is used in nuclear reactors because it acts as a moderator in slowing down the neutrons that are produced during the fission reaction. This further helps in sustaining the chain reaction allowing the nuclear reactor to operate efficiently and with stability.

What are the uses of heavy water?

Uses of heavy water:

  • Heavy water is used as neutron moderator in nuclear reactors.
  • Heavy water is used in Neuclear Magnetic Resonance(NMR) spectroscopy.
  • Heavy water is used in Fourier Transform Infrared(FTIR) Spectroscopy of proteins.
  • Heavy water is used for metabolic rate testing in physiology and biology.

What are heavy water used for?

The heavy water produced is used as a moderator of neutrons in nuclear power plants. In the laboratory heavy water is employed as an isotopic tracer in studies of chemical and biochemical processes.
